Step-by-Step Guide to Relocating Without Stress
1. Start Planning Early
Early preparation is your best ally when it comes to relocating with ease. As soon as you know you'll be moving, create a timeline. List all tasks that need to be accomplished and assign deadlines. The earlier you start, the more control you'll have over each stage.
- Set a moving date and stick to it.
- Book moving services or a rental truck in advance.
- Notify your landlord or real estate agent as needed.
2. Declutter and Downsize
One of the best ways to relocate without feeling overwhelmed is by paring down your belongings. Use this move as an opportunity to take an inventory and let go of what no longer serves you.
- Sort items into "keep," "donate," "sell," and "discard" piles.
- Host a garage sale or list items online to make extra cash.
- Donate gently used goods to local charities or shelters.
Less clutter means fewer boxes to pack and unpack, saving you time and money.
3. Create a Detailed Moving Checklist
To move without all the stress, organize every aspect of your relocation with a comprehensive checklist. Document everything, from transferring utilities to changing your address. Here are some essential items to include:
- Inform banks, subscriptions, and employers of your new address.
- Plan for school transfers if you have children.
- Arrange pet transport and medical records.
- Schedule final cleaning and repairs at your old home.
Having a checklist keeps you on track and helps prevent last-minute surprises.
4. Pack Smarter, Not Harder
Packing can either be chaotic or seamlessly organized. Here are top packing tips to relocate without chaos:
- Label Every Box: Write both the room and a summary of contents on each box.
- Use Quality Packing Materials: Invest in sturdy boxes, bubble wrap, and packing tape to protect your belongings.
- Pack One Room at a Time: This method keeps you organized and makes unpacking easier.
- Create an "Essentials Box": Fill it with necessary items such as toiletries, medications, chargers, and important documents. This will save you from scrambling on your first night.
- Don't Overpack Boxes: Keep each box to a manageable weight, especially for fragile items.
5. Enlist Professional Help
Hiring reputable movers can greatly reduce relocation stress. Look for companies with positive reviews and proper insurance. Get multiple quotes before booking, and ensure every detail is in writing.
If on a budget, consider enlisting friends or family, but always communicate expectations clearly and express your gratitude.
6. Take Care of Utilities and Services
To avoid unnecessary hassle on moving day, make arrangements in advance for:
- Transferring or setting up utilities at your new address.
- Cancelling or forwarding subscriptions and services.
- Arranging internet and cable installations, if necessary.
7. Plan for the Unexpected
No matter how meticulously you prepare, surprises can happen. Build extra time into your schedule, have backup plans, and focus on solutions instead of stress when things don't go exactly as expected.
- Store an emergency kit with snacks, water, and first aid items.
- Keep a list of important contacts handy.
8. Take Care of Yourself and Your Loved Ones
Moving can be an emotional experience. Be gentle with yourself and others throughout the process.
- Take regular breaks during packing and moving days.
- Stay hydrated and eat nutritious meals.
- Talk openly about feelings and expectations with your family.
If you're relocating with children or pets, help them adjust by maintaining routines and providing reassurance. Change can be unsettling, but your support will make a world of difference.

Post-Move: Settling in With Minimal Stress
Pace Yourself While Unpacking
There's no rule that says everything must be unpacked immediately. Establish priorities:
- Set up bedrooms and bathrooms first.
- Make the kitchen functional.
- Organize living spaces for comfort and relaxation.
Take breaks, and remember to celebrate the small milestones as you make your new space feel like home.
Update Important Records
- Register your new address with the post office.
- Update your driver's license and vehicle registration, if necessary.
- Contact healthcare providers and insurance companies to transfer or update records.
Staying on top of paperwork ensures you won't miss bills, packages, or important communications.

Relocation Stress FAQs
How far in advance should I start preparing for a move?
Ideally, begin planning at least two months before your move. This timeframe allows you to tackle tasks gradually and avoid last-minute stress.
What's the most common mistake people make when moving?
The biggest mistake is waiting too long to start packing. Procrastination can lead to haphazard packing, lost items, and unnecessary anxiety.
How can I help my kids transition smoothly during relocation?
Involve children in the process, keep routines consistent, and talk openly about the move. Visit the new neighborhood together when possible, and encourage them to share their feelings.
